WebDefinition ofIncome inequality. Income is defined as household disposable income in a particular year. It consists of earnings, self-employment and capital income and public cash transfers; income taxes and social security contributions paid by households are deducted. The income of the household is attributed to each of its members, with an ...

WebFact #3: The gap in poverty rates by sex are widest for women and men aged 25–34. Women are particularly vulnerable to poverty between ages 25 and 34, when they are most likely to have young children as shown globally in the figure. This observation holds across all three poverty thresholds and across regions. Web28 Nov 2016 · Absolute Poverty: This is an income below a certain level necessary to maintain a minimum standard of living. (e.g. enough money to buy the basic necessities of food, shelter and heat. Therefore, economic growth should reduce absolute poverty, so long as the poorest can gain some increase in living standards from the nation’s growth.

Web10 Feb 2024 · The disadvantage gap at GCSE is large, and outcomes for the very poorest students in long-term poverty have failed to improve after a decade. The disadvantage gap – the gap in GCSE grades between students on free school meals (at one point over the last six years) and their better off peers – was on average 1.24 grades in 2024.
